简要总结
Inguinal hernias are the most common operative procedures performed by general surgeons. Various procedures described to improve outcome in terms of decrease chronic pain and recurrence. Lichtenstein hernia repair showed a significant reduction in recurrence and also chronic pain. Usage of lightweight mesh materials like polyester is found to reduce inguinal hernia pain as compared to polypropylene mesh and improve quality of life. Prosthetic materials induce an inflammatory response characterized by an increased level of IL-6 and hsCRP.
Chronic pain is that pain which persists at the surgical site and nearby surrounding tissues 3 months after surgery. Despite adequate research chronic postoperative pain continues to be a significant problem in hernioplasty. Polyester mesh has a higher degree of connective tissue integration, it has less mesh contraction, less fibrous encapsulation and less stiffness around the mesh. Prosthetic materials induce an inflammatory response characterized by an increased level of IL-6 and hsCRP, however, there is no significant difference between preoperative
level, 12 hr, 48hr, and 2weeks. The main reasons hypothesized for chronic groin pain are per-operative nerve damage, post-operative fibrosis, or mesh-related fibrosis. They have been classified as either neuropathic or non-neuropathic pain. The three nerves potentially involved are the Ilioinguinal Nerve (IIN), Iliohypogastric Nerve (IHN) and genital branch of the Genitofemoral Nerve (GFN). These nerves can be damaged either by trauma during dissection or retraction of tissues, or nerve entrapment from post-operative fibrosis, mesh-related fibrosis or sutures used to fix the mesh. Non-neuropathic causes are excessive scar formation resulting from prosthetic mesh reaction, the periosteal reaction from sutures or staples inserted into the pubic tubercle or due to rolled-up bulky mesh leading to mechanical pressure. Hereby we are conducting a study to compare the efficacy between polypropylene mesh and polyester mesh in terms of pain, inflammatory changes
